Description
This Easy Italian Broccoli Pasta is the perfect simple weeknight meal. It’s a 30-minute, one-skillet sauce recipe featuring savory Italian sausage, tender broccoli, and a light, flavorful garlic and broth sauce.
Ingredients
1 lb Pasta (Penne or Farfalle)1 tbsp Olive Oil1 lb Italian Sausage (mild, sweet, or hot), casings removed1 medium Yellow Onion, diced5 cloves Garlic, minced1/4 tsp Red Pepper Flakes1 large head Broccoli, cut into small florets1 cup Chicken Broth1/2 cup Grated Parmesan CheeseSalt and Black Pepper to taste
Instructions
1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ook pasta according to package directions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water before draining.2. While pasta cooks, heat olive oil in a large, deep skillet over medium-high heat. Add the Italian sausage (casings removed). Cook, breaking it apart with a spoon, until browned and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es.3. Do not drain the fat. Add the diced onion to the skillet with the sausage fat. Sauté for 3-4 minutes until softened.4. Add the minced garlic and red pepper flakes. Cook for 1 more minute until fragrant.5. Add the broccoli florets and the chicken broth. Stir to combine.6. Bring the broth to a simmer, then cover the skillet. Let the broccoli steam for 3-5 minutes, until tender-crisp.7. Uncover the skillet. Add the cooked, drained pasta to the skillet along with the grated Parmesan and 1/2 cup of the reserved pasta water.8. Stir everything together vigorously for 1-2 minutes, allowing the sauce to thicken and coat the pasta. If it seems dry, add more pasta water.9.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Serve immediately.
Notes
Sausage: Use hot, mild, or sweet Italian sausage based on your preference. If using leaner chicken sausage, you may need to add an extra tablespoon of olive oil.Broccoli: Don’t overcook the broccoli! You want it to be bright green and tender-crisp, not mushy.Pasta Water: The starchy pasta water is key to creating a glossy sauce that clings to the pasta, rather than a watery one.
